机器学习简介之基础理论- 线性回归、逻辑回归、神经网络
http://blog.itpub.net/29829936/viewspace-2640084/
本文主要介绍一些机器学习的基础概念和推导过程,并基于这些基础概念,快速地了解当下最热技术AI的核心基础-神经网络
主要分为三大部分:线性回归,逻辑回归,神经网络。
首先看下机器学习的定义及常用的分类:
我们从一元线性回归这个基础领域切入
这样一元线性回归的问题到此结束,我们延伸到多元的场景下继续
之前提到了多项式回归基本可以拟合任何复杂的曲线,这样理论上我们已经解决了大部分预测问题。
然而现实中我们面临更多的分类问题,对给定样本,推断其类别,那么用线性回归显然不适合的。
由此引出逻辑回归,从统计学和概率论给出答案。
我们解决了to be or not to be这个二元的分类问题,那么如果面临的是多元分类问题,我们该如何解决呢?
以下是神经网络部分,主要讲解了当下最火的深度学习的理论基石,神经网络这种古老的技术是如何在当下发挥重要作用的。
因此我们说神经网络有自学习的功能,可以学习出来我们无法直接表述的隐性特征,而这些特征正是机器可以模拟人类来认知世界的方式。
我们再回过头来看之前用逻辑回归解决多元分类的问题,神经网络给出了更优雅的答案。
以上主要讲述了机器学习中监督学习理论中的主要枝干部分。
无监督学习也可以为我们提供很多解决问题的方案。
机器学习简介之基础理论- 线性回归、逻辑回归、神经网络相关推荐
- 逻辑回归和线性回归的区别_机器学习简介之基础理论- 线性回归、逻辑回归、神经网络...
本文主要介绍一些机器学习的基础概念和推导过程,并基于这些基础概念,快速地了解当下最热技术AI的核心基础-神经网络. 主要分为三大部分:线性回归,逻辑回归,神经网络. 首先看下机器学习的定义及常用的分类 ...
- 机器学习学习吴恩达逻辑回归_机器学习基础:逻辑回归
机器学习学习吴恩达逻辑回归 In the previous stories, I had given an explanation of the program for implementation ...
- 吴恩达《机器学习》学习笔记五——逻辑回归
吴恩达<机器学习>学习笔记五--逻辑回归 一. 分类(classification) 1.定义 2.阈值 二. 逻辑(logistic)回归假设函数 1.假设的表达式 2.假设表达式的意义 ...
- python机器学习手写算法系列——逻辑回归
从机器学习到逻辑回归 今天,我们只关注机器学习到线性回归这条线上的概念.别的以后再说.为了让大家听懂,我这次也不查维基百科了,直接按照自己的理解用大白话说,可能不是很严谨. 机器学习就是机器可以自己学 ...
- 线性回归 逻辑回归
分类就是到底是1类别还是0类别. 回归就是预测的不是一个类别的值,而是一个具体的值,具体借给你多少钱哪? 一.回归分析 回归分析(英语:Regression Analysis)是一种统计学上分析数据的 ...
- 机器学习第四章之逻辑回归模型
逻辑回归模型 4.1 逻辑回归模型算法原理 4.1.1 逻辑回归模型的数学原理(了解) 4.1.2 逻辑回归模型的代码实现(重要) 4.1.3 逻辑回归模型的深入理解 4.2 案例实战 - 股票客户流 ...
- 吴恩达《机器学习》学习笔记七——逻辑回归(二分类)代码
吴恩达<机器学习>学习笔记七--逻辑回归(二分类)代码 一.无正则项的逻辑回归 1.问题描述 2.导入模块 3.准备数据 4.假设函数 5.代价函数 6.梯度下降 7.拟合参数 8.用训练 ...
- 李宏毅机器学习课程5~~~分类:逻辑回归
Function Set 不同的w,b来确定不同的函数,这样就组成了函数集合,不同的w,b可以来表达不同的分布函数. Good of a Function 变换表达形式 两个Bernoulli dis ...
- 逻辑回归(神经网络Sigmod激活函数,计量logit模型)
逻辑回归(Logistic Regression) 逻辑回归(Logistic Regression)是通过回归来解决分类问题,为监督学习方法,比较线性回归与逻辑回归,线性回归当变量有较好的线性关系时 ...
最新文章
- CF558E A Simple Task 线段树
- python中 __name__及__main()__的妙处02
- 基于HTML5的WebGL结合Box2DJS物理引擎应用
- openoffice java在线预览,使用openoffice和kkFileView实现文档在线预览
- 【无码专区13】最小公倍数(线段树)
- 1081. Rational Sum (20) -最大公约数
- python 风玫瑰图_python之windrose风向玫瑰图的用法
- 黑客编程为什么首选Python语言?这个高速你答案!
- Javascript 之 变量
- Spring中AOP源码剖析
- 一场价值4500亿的抉择
- Ubuntu18.04安装ROS Melodic(解决网络原因,先将所需压缩包下载到本地,然后rosdep update)
- 三网 —— 计算机网络、电信网络、广播电视网络(移动网络)
- windows中mysql5.7中配置中文字符集和默认datadir
- centos 编译Qt5 mysql驱动_centos7安装编译mysql的驱动的问题
- 秋招历险记-计算机网络篇
- 旋转编码器EC11_支持长按、短按、双击、顺时针逆时针
- 数据库实战踩坑指南1:取前N项,需要WITH TIES
- 前端网页版ps,你用过了吗?
- Android 手机上利用adb shell模拟手机相关操作
热门文章
- GMM-HMM语音识别算法
- 转载 jsonrpc环境搭建和简单实例
- servlet工作原理_Servlet 生命周期、工作原理
- OpenAI透露GPT-4动向:文本与视觉融合,人类反馈+强化学习解决安全问题 | AI日报...
- 那些大家情有独钟的好书,以后由你来推荐!
- 听说「面向对象是怎样工作的?」是一道送命题?| 7月书讯
- 程序员能成为设计师吗
- COLING 2018 ⽤对抗增强的端到端模型⽣成合理且多样的故事结尾
- 斯坦福公开课 密码学 cryptography 1 思维导图
- 70页论文,图灵奖得主Yoshua Bengio一作:“生成流网络”拓展深度学习领域